Rosewill Launches THRONE Gaming Enclosure

While this is not the first time we're seeing the THRONE name from Rosewill, it is only now that Rosewill has officially announced that the THRONE series of gaming cases is available.

The cases have a rather extensive feature set, and as advertised, are targeted towards gamers and enthusiasts. As such, the case features room for up to ten 2.5" or 3.5" drives, three optical drives, graphics cards up to 320 mm in length, a bottom mounted PSU, and it features an impressive 25 mm of space behind the motherboard tray for cable management.

Cooling in the case is also well achieved. There is support for up to eight 140 mm fans and another four 120 mm fans. Five of the 140 mm fans come pre-installed, as well as another 230 mm fan on top of the case.

The case also has a rather interesting front I/O configuration, which is not a bad thing this time. It features a built-in docking station for 2.5" or 3.5" drives, as well as a total of four USB 2.0 connectors, two USB 3.0 connectors, and topped off with a pair of HD audio jacks.

Rosewill is releasing the cases in four different versions -- a windowed gun-metal black version, a windowed black version, a white version, and another black version. Street pricing is around $160.
